description Product Description

Used as a chiral building block in the synthesis of pharmaceutical intermediates, particularly in the development of protease inhibitors and other bioactive molecules. Its fluorinated alkyl chain enhances metabolic stability and membrane permeability in drug candidates. The Boc-protected amine allows for selective deprotection and coupling in peptide-like structures, making it valuable in medicinal chemistry for structure-activity relationship studies. Commonly employed in asymmetric synthesis to introduce fluorinated, branched amino acid motifs into complex molecules.
